CONFIGURATION OF REGULAR SYSTEMS - PRESTIGE SOLO (2 PUMPS)
This section contains information on the electrical connections, hydraulic connections and ACVMax
controller set-up for Prestige 42-50-75-100-120 Solo, that are required to operate the system
configuration you have selected.
For simple configurations, the EZ setup function of the ACVMax can be used (refer to the Installation,
Operation and Maintenance manual provided with the appliance).
For more complex systems, with additional pumps, several configurations have already been preset
in the ACVMax controller to help you. Please refer to the following pages to see the predetermined
configurations as well as the relevant information for the cascade systems.
For any system that is not mentioned in this manual, please contact your ACV representative.
GENERAL
PUMPS
The pump configurator system is based on the demands of the hydraulic system that you design. In the
table below, you will find the 13 configurations that have been preset in the ACVMax controller for the
Prestige 42-50-75-100-120 Solo (identified as "Solo (2 pumps)" in the Prestige Model selection menu),
based on different hydraulic schemes that can be used.
The table shows which relays are activated under which condition.
The names in the table refer to the demand done by CH1 by CH2 or DHW respectively, the demand to
open close the Motor of a mixing valve or reflect the activation of the alarm (error) or Flame output relay.
In the following pages, you will find these diagrams with a configuration number that corresponds to
the setting in the display.
